Embryologist

US Fertility

Opportunity Overview We have an immediate opening for an Embryologist to join our team at IVF Florida in Margate, Florida. Schedule: Sunday through Thursday, 8:00 AM to 4:00 PM, with rotating holidays as needed Responsibilities In this role, the Embryologist will: Clinical and Technical Standards Perform the following aspects of Assisted Reproductive technology (ART) procedures including but not necessarily limited to: oocyte retrieval, sperm preparation for insemination, in‑vitro fertilization (IVF), fertilization check, embryo evaluation, selection of embryos for transfer and vitrification, embryo vitrification, embryo thawing, embryo transfer, surgical sperm retrieval and processing, cell to tube transfer of embryo biopsy material, micromanipulation, ICSI, assisted hatching, embryo biopsy Prepare embryo culture dishes and solutions required for ART procedures using sterile tissue culture techniques Perform embryology and andrology proficiency testing required by CAP-approved agency (ABB, CAP) Assure proper sample collection, delivery and identification, including PGT samples for release Perform safe handling of specimens by following the safety guidelines for biohazardous, infectious and toxic substances in the IVF laboratory Document quality assurance activities including description of unusual incidents, problems, and appropriate corrective action Perform daily/weekly quality control for procedures and equipment used in the IVF Laboratory Prepare semen specimens for intrauterine inseminations (IUIs) Perform all aspects of reproductive tissue (sperm, oocyte and embryo) cryopreservation/vitrification including sample identification, inventories, checks of serology screening, freezing and thawing procedures Maintain laboratory records, reports, quality assurance data and assist in preparation of SART, Artworks, and Cryomodule data Assist in the preparation of data for clinical meetings Operate laboratory equipment including laminar flow hoods, microscopes, centrifuges, analytical balance, pH meter Set up, calibrate and clean laboratory equipment and glassware, and assure routine maintenance and repairs are performed and documented Perform various office functions including photocopying, answering telephones, scheduling appointments, faxing and filing reports Laboratory Services/Operations Attend monthly IVF laboratory meetings and periodic staff meetings Assist in research projects under the IVF Laboratory Director’s supervision Assist in training and assigning work to junior IVF support staff Communicate with center personnel, medical staff, patients and outside resources to ensure high quality patient care Assist laboratory personnel in performing laboratory services in accordance with Federal, State and local laws and guidelines to ensure laboratory maintains accreditation Assist as required in maintaining laboratory operations in conformity with OSHA and CLIA ‘88 regulations Must meet CLIA ‘88 requirements of education and experience for General Supervisor or Technical Supervisor Must be thoroughly familiar with Laboratory Operations Manual Must demonstrate skills and aptitude appropriate to the position Must demonstrate an ability to function effectively without direct supervision and to perform laboratory services in accord with the Laboratory Philosophy and Operating Standards Must demonstrate a good work ethic and commitment to participate in appropriate programs of continuing education and professional development to maintain up‑to‑date knowledge in the laboratory specialty What You’ll Bring We’re looking for professionals who bring both technical skill and a deep sense of responsibility to the care experience—individuals who thrive in environments where excellence, empathy, and accountability matter.
